Alta Audio Updates The StandMount Celesta FRM-2

Alta Audio Celesta FRM-2

As summer slowly gives way to the holiday buying season, product releases start to heat up in their own special way. Announced late this weekend, Alta Audio will be updating their original standmount Celesta FRM-2 with several new revisions moving forward.

The 55 lb, 4 ohm speaker still utilizes a ribbon tweeter, a 6″ woofer and polyester finish cabinet, but will now offer many updates to the internal bits that help make up the rest of heart and soul of the product. According to the press release: “Among the updates are upgraded cabling, new conductors and capacitors, a new magnetic grille, and next-level DampHard material that helps to create an acoustically dead, resonance-free speaker.”

The Celesta FRM-2 would definitely qualify as high-end within the two channel audiophile crowd as retail asking price is $18k a pair.

Expect shipping to start this month with the new updates.
